Job Vacancy For Clearing Supervisor
Job Summary
Job Details
The Clearing Supervisor shall be responsible for:
Manage end-to-end customs clearance processes for imports and exports, including preparation and verification of all required documentation and coordination with customs authorities, port officials, and regulatory agencies.
Liaise with Ghana Revenue Authority (Customs Division), port authorities, shipping lines, and freight forwarders to facilitate efficient clearance of consignments.
Identify, troubleshoot, and resolve customs-related issues, including delays, discrepancies, and documentation errors.
Ensure zero demurrage, detention, UCL, penalties, or storage charges on all consignments through proactive monitoring and planning.
Ensure full compliance with all Ghanaian customs regulations, as well as applicable international trade laws and standards.
Maintain up-to-date knowledge of Ghanaian import/export laws, tariffs, port procedures, and international logistics requirements.
Ensure all logistics operations meet regulatory compliance standards required for manufacturing and supply chain operations.
Oversee the planning and execution of logistics activities from port clearance to final delivery, including transportation and warehousing coordination.
Develop and maintain strong working relationships with transporters, clearing agents, shipping lines, and third-party logistics providers.
Lead, supervise, and develop a team of logistics coordinators and support staff to ensure efficient and compliant operations.
Provide regular training and updates to team members on logistics best practices, safety standards, and regulatory changes.
Prepare detailed logistics and clearance reports, including cost analysis, timelines, shipment status, and any disruptions or delays.
Analyze logistics and clearance processes to identify opportunities for efficiency improvements and cost reduction.
Collate and document all cases of quality issues and non-conformance raised by regulatory bodies (e.g., customs, standards authorities) and track corrective and preventive actions.
Requirements
Skills and Attributes Required:
Good working knowledge of Ghana Customs procedures, including GCNet/ICUMS systems and port operations.
Solid understanding of import/export processes, including documentation, Incoterms, duties, tariffs, and clearance procedures.
Experience working with clearing agents, transporters, and logistics service providers.
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and basic logistics or ERP systems.
Strong organizational, communication, and coordination skills.
Ability to troubleshoot clearance issues and manage multiple shipments simultaneously.
High level of integrity and willingness to learn and adapt to regulatory changes.
Proven leadership or supervisory skills.
A conscious SAFETY champion at all levels of operation.
Qualification Required & Experience
Bachelor’s degree in Logistics, Supply Chain Management, Business Administration, or a related field.
Minimum of 5–6 years’ experience in customs clearing, freight forwarding, or port operations in Ghana, preferably within beverage manufacturing or related industries.
Professional certification (e.g., CILT, FIATA) is an advantage.
Valid Ghanaian driver’s license is an advantage.
